Flagship Communities Real Estate Investment Trust Wins the Kentucky Manufactured Housing Institute’s Highest Award for the Fourth Consecutive Year
Globenewswire·2025-06-19 20:42

Core Viewpoint - Flagship Communities Real Estate Investment Trust's Derby Hills Pointe community has been awarded the 2025 Community of the Year by the Kentucky Manufactured Housing Institute, marking the fourth consecutive year the company has received this honor, reflecting its commitment to building high-quality residential communities [1][2]. Company Overview - Flagship Communities Real Estate Investment Trust operates affordable residential Manufactured Housing Communities primarily aimed at working families seeking affordable home ownership [3]. - The REIT owns and manages residential living experiences across several states, including Kentucky, Indiana, Ohio, Tennessee, Arkansas, Missouri, West Virginia, and Illinois [3]. Community Development - Flagship acquired the 170-lot Derby Hills Pointe in 2015 and has since made significant improvements, including infrastructure upgrades and community amenities such as a new clubhouse, solar street lighting, a playground, basketball courts, and a dog park [2]. - The community also features a resident-driven food pantry, partnerships with local churches for back-to-school programs, and organizes annual events like Halloween parties and Thanksgiving meal donations [2].
